Grosvenor-Strathmore Metro Station
Metro station
Photo: SchuminWeb,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Grosvenor–Strathmore station is a rapid transit station on the Red Line of the Washington Metro in Montgomery County, Maryland. Grosvenor–Strathmore is the last above-ground station for Glenmont-bound Red Line trains until NoMa-Gallaudet U; south of the station, trains cross over the Capital Beltway before descending underground. Strathmore
Arts center
Photo: Kmf164, CC BY-SA 2.5.
Strathmore is a cultural and artistic venue and institution in North Bethesda, Maryland, United States. Strathmore was founded in 1981 and consists of two venues: the Mansion and the Music Center. Strathmore is situated 860 feet northwest of Grosvenor Metro Station Parking.

Chevy Chase View
Village
Photo: Famartin,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Chevy Chase View is a town in Montgomery County, Maryland, United States. Established as a Special Tax District in 1924, the town was formally incorporated on October 28, 1993. The population was 1,005 at the 2020 census.
